The Honda Civic Hybrid 2026 builds on Honda’s strong name for fuel saving, daily comfort, and long life. It is made mainly for the US market and suits people who drive every day and families as well. This hybrid sedan helps cut fuel cost without taking away driving fun. It feels like a smart choice for real life use.

Modern and Refined Exterior Design

The Honda Civic Hybrid 2026 comes with a clean and modern look. The slim LED headlights and smooth front design give it a sporty feel. Its body shape helps air flow better, which improves fuel use. Small hybrid badges set it apart but keep the look simple and balanced.

Efficient and Smooth Hybrid Powertrain

This Civic Hybrid uses a smart mix of a petrol engine and electric motors. It gives quick power at low speed, which helps a lot in city traffic. On highways, it focuses on saving fuel and smooth driving. The system shifts modes on its own to give the best mileage possible.

Performance and Fuel Efficiency Details

The hybrid setup is tuned for daily comfort and steady performance. It does not feel noisy or jerky while driving. You get strong fuel economy numbers, which make it one of the best in its class. This helps drivers save money every month.

Comfortable Ride and Balanced Handling

The Civic Hybrid 2026 is made to feel relaxed on rough roads. Its suspension handles bumps well and keeps the ride soft. Steering feels light but confident, which helps in traffic and turns. Battery placement keeps the car stable at higher speeds.

Spacious and Practical Interior

Inside the cabin, the Civic Hybrid feels open and well planned. Seats are soft and supportive for long trips. Both front and back passengers get good leg and head space. The cabin stays quiet, especially when running on electric power in the city.

Technology and Infotainment Features

The infotainment system is easy to use and beginner friendly. It supports Apple CarPlay and Android Auto for daily use. A digital display shows fuel use and driving data clearly. Buttons and controls are placed where they feel natural.

Advanced Safety and Driver Assistance

Safety is a strong point of the Civic Hybrid 2026. Honda Sensing comes standard on all models. It helps the driver stay safe and relaxed on long drives. These features are useful for new and experienced drivers.

Safety FeatureIncluded
Adaptive Cruise ControlYes
Lane Keeping AssistYes
Collision BrakingYes
Road Departure AlertYes

Reliability and Low Ownership Cost

Honda cars are known for lasting a long time, and this hybrid is no different. The hybrid system is built for daily use and low service needs. Fuel saving helps reduce running cost over the years. Strong resale value adds more long term benefit.

Expected Price and US Availability

The Honda Civic Hybrid 2026 is expected to start near $28,000 in the US. The price may change with trim and features. It costs more than the normal Civic but saves money in fuel. Over time, this makes it a smart buy.
